How they compare
Kyrgyzstan currently reports 481.53 billion current LCU against 479.88 billion current LCU in Ethiopia, a difference of 1.66 billion current LCU.
The two have swapped places 2 times across 11 shared years of data; in 2014 it was Kyrgyzstan ahead.
Ethiopia ranks 74th and Kyrgyzstan ranks 73rd of 157 countries.
Ethiopia has averaged higher in every one of the 2 decades both report.

About this data
Revenue, excluding grants (current LCU) with 57 missing years estimated by linear interpolation between the nearest real observations. Only gaps of 4 years or fewer are filled, and never beyond the first or last actual measurement — these are filled holes, not forecasts.
